The Department of Environmental Protection (DEP) is seeking a Semi Skilled Laborer to join our team within the Bureau of Abandoned Mine Reclamation. Apply today and use heavy equipment, hand tools, and computerized machinery to help control acid mine drainage affecting Pennsylvania watersheds.

DESCRIPTION OF WORK In this position, you will assist the Bureau of Abandoned Mine Reclamation in the operation and maintenance of active and passive acid mine drainage treatment facilities to help abate and control acid mine drainage affecting the Toby Creek, Bennett Branch, and Sinnemahoning Creek watersheds. Work includes repairing and maintaining motors, mixers, pumps, and other equipment used in the process of acid mine drainage as well as monitoring inventory levels, inputting data into DEP's electronic data systems, and collecting water samples from off-site locations.
